How We Listened to Young Vapers
The study employed a rigorous qualitative research approach, ensuring a diverse and representative sample of participants. Recruitment took place through social media and online forums, targeting young people aged 18-25 with varying levels of disposable vape experience.
Data collection involved open-ended questions and discussions, allowing participants to freely express their thoughts, preferences, and concerns. Thematic analysis techniques were then applied to identify recurring patterns and themes within the collected data, providing a comprehensive understanding of the qualitative aspects of disposable vape use among young people.

Drawbacks
While disposable vapes offer convenience, participants expressed concerns about the recurring costs associated with their use. As these devices are designed for single-use, frequent vapers found the expenses to be a significant drawback, potentially leading to financial strain.
Another notable concern highlighted in the study was the environmental impact of disposable vapes. Participants acknowledged the waste generated by these devices, prompting calls for manufacturers to explore more sustainable alternatives and consider the long-term ecological implications.
Satisfaction Levels
Despite the drawbacks, participants generally reported high levels of satisfaction with disposable vapes. The combination of convenience, flavour variety, and the perceived benefits contributed to an overall positive experience for many young vapers.
